Tagine recipes
Tagine is a slow-cooked North African dish known for its complex, rich flavours. It shares the name with the pot it is traditionally cooked in – a shallow bowl with a conical lid. As the food cooks, steam rises, condenses, then runs back down to the food, creating a moreish, tender result.
